History of the Republic of China Armed Forces
The history of the Republic of China Armed Forces traces back to its establishment in 1925 under the leadership of Generalissimo Chiang Kai-shek. Initially known as the National Revolutionary Army, it played a crucial role in China’s tumultuous transition period, including the Second Sino-Japanese War and the Chinese Civil War.
Following the Chinese Civil War, the armed forces retreated to Taiwan with the Chinese Nationalist government in 1949. Since then, the Republic of China Armed Forces has developed into a modern military organization, adapting to the geopolitical shifts in the Asia-Pacific region while maintaining its historical significance.

Command hierarchy
The Republic of China Armed Forces boasts a well-defined command hierarchy that ensures effective coordination and decision-making across its diverse branches. The structure follows a clear chain of command, pivotal for operational efficiency and swift responses in times of crisis. This hierarchy is instrumental in maintaining discipline and strategic alignment within the military organization.
Key components of the command hierarchy include:
-
Supreme Commander: The President of Taiwan serves as the highest authority and the Supreme Commander of the Armed Forces.
-
Ministry of National Defense (MND): Directly under the President’s purview, the Ministry of National Defense oversees the overall defense strategy and policy formulation.
-
Chief of the General Staff: Positioned at the apex of the operational command, the Chief of the General Staff is responsible for the execution of military operations and coordination among various military branches.
-
Branch Commanders: Each branch of the military, such as the Army, Navy, Air Force, and Special Forces, has its respective commander accountable for the strategic planning and operational readiness of their forces.

Branches of the military
The Republic of China Armed Forces consist of several branches, each specializing in different aspects of military operations. These branches include the Army, Navy, Air Force, Military Police, and Reserve Forces. The Army is responsible for land-based operations and safeguarding the nation’s borders. The Navy operates at sea, safeguarding maritime interests, and conducting naval defense.
The Air Force is tasked with aerial defense and provides air support for ground and naval forces. The Military Police ensure discipline and security within the military, handling law enforcement and internal security matters. The Reserve Forces play a crucial role in augmenting the active-duty military in times of need, providing additional manpower and support for defense operations.
